Автор Тема: Ёше раз про картинки из БД  (Прочитано 3374 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н linker

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 25
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Ёше раз про картинки из БД
« : 14 Февраля 2005, 17:13:03 »
В php

header
("Content-type: image/jpeg");
$sql =\'SELECT ris FROM label where label.name_label=\\\'\'.$val.\'\\\'\'; 
$res=$db->query($sql); 
$row = $res->fetchRow();
echo $row[0]; 

В html ,так не работает,а вот так
 
<? require \'ristest.php\'?>

Работает но не так как надо(т.е получается не картинка , а набор символов но это и понятно, непонятно почему в img не передается параметр).Как правильно, подскажите.Насчет того что картинке на диске хранить надо, это я читал, но мне конкретно надо из базы вытаскивать.

Оффлайн Lutik

  • Фанат форума
  • Постоялец
  • ***
  • Сообщений: 184
  • +0/-0
  • 0
    • Просмотр профиля
    • http://www.galiongroup.ru
Ёше раз про картинки из БД
« Ответ #1 : 15 Февраля 2005, 12:19:38 »
Я думаю что надо воспользоватся библиотекой gd!
http://phpclub.net/manrus/feat/images.html
Разум когда-нибудь победит

Оффлайн linker

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 25
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Ёше раз про картинки из БД
« Ответ #2 : 15 Февраля 2005, 13:04:39 »
Зачем?????????Может я чего не допонял.

Оффлайн linker

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 25
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Ёше раз про картинки из БД
« Ответ #3 : 15 Февраля 2005, 13:15:51 »
У меня с картинкой все нормально, а вот параметр в image че-то не передается

Оффлайн Lutik

  • Фанат форума
  • Постоялец
  • ***
  • Сообщений: 184
  • +0/-0
  • 0
    • Просмотр профиля
    • http://www.galiongroup.ru
Ёше раз про картинки из БД
« Ответ #4 : 15 Февраля 2005, 13:24:43 »
А вообще ты прав! GD не надо!
Отправь заголовок перед echo!
т.е.

$sql 
=\'SELECT ris FROM label where label.name_label=\'\'.$val.\'\'\'; 
$res=$db->query($sql); 
$row = $res->fetchRow();
header("Content-type: image/jpeg");
echo $row[0];
Разум когда-нибудь победит

Оффлайн Меняздесьдавнонет

  • новичЕк
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 5698
  • +0/-0
  • 2
    • Просмотр профиля
    • http://

Оффлайн linker

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 25
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Ёше раз про картинки из БД
« Ответ #6 : 15 Февраля 2005, 15:37:50 »
<img src="ristest.php?val=<?=$val?>>Вот так все работает.

 

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28